Can see multiple displays in Windows 10?
Set up dual monitors on Windows 10
- Select Start > Settings > System > Display.
- In the Multiple displays section, select an option from the list to determine how your desktop will display across your screens.
- Once you’ve selected what you see on your displays, select Keep changes.

How do I setup multiple monitors on Windows 10?
How do I setup multiple monitors in Windows 10?
Windows 10
- Right click on an empty area of the desktop.
- Choose Display Settings.
- Scroll Down to the Multiple displays area and select select Duplicate these displays or Extend these displays.
How do I get Windows 10 to recognize my third monitor?
Right-click your desktop and select Display settings (Windows 10) or Screen resolution (Windows 7,8). Here you can confirm if all of your displays are detected. If not, click Detect. If yes, drag the three monitors to match your display configuration.

What computers support dual monitors?
Know that most laptops can support dual monitors. If you have a laptop which has at least one video output slot (e.g., an HDMI port or a VGA port ), you can usually use an external monitor in conjunction with the video port.
How do I setup multiple monitors on my laptop?
Press the “Start” button and select ” Control Panel .”. Type “display” in the search box near the top-right corner of the window. Click “Connect to an external display.”. The default setting under “Multiple displays” is “Duplicate these displays.”. This mirrors your laptop screen onto the monitor.
Can my computer support multiple monitors?
Desktop Windows computers normally have these ports on the back of the computer case. If you only see one video output on a desktop computer, your computer’s graphics card only supports one monitor at a time. Laptops which have one video output port can usually support multiple monitors.
